JR Smith:

Actually, yes, in a way. I was in Houston with Rashard Lewis, another former NBA player. He was an incredible shooter and introduced me to golf at his foundation event. Initially, I had no interest, but he invited me to show support. My upbringing emphasized the importance of giving back, especially to someone I respected like a big brother. It was at this event that I met Moses Malone, who truly introduced me to golf. Despite my hesitation, his encouragement led me to take a swing, and just like that, I was hooked.

The Role of Eyewear in Enhancing Athletic Performance

Dr. Darryl Glover:

It’s amazing how a single experience can spark such a passion. Now, with your partnership with Oakley, I’m curious about the eyewear technology that aids your game. What makes the Oakley frames you wear so effective?

JR Smith:

My awareness of eye care was minimal until I realized three of my daughters needed glasses. Through them, I learned the importance of proper vision. Initially, I didn’t wear sunglasses while playing, but partnering with Oakley changed that. Wearing their sunglasses, I’ve noticed a significant difference in my game, especially in spotting the ball, reading the greens, and tracking the ball’s flight. It’s been a game-changer, allowing me to see more clearly and perform better on the course.

Indeed, realizing the stark contrast in visibility with the right eyewear compared to my previous skepticism has been a game-changer. The difference is like night and day, significantly improving my performance, especially around the greens and with putting. Hitting the correct lines is crucial, and the lens technology has been a tremendous help.

JR Smith:

Absolutely, the improvement in my game thanks to the lens technology is undeniable. And the comfort? That’s been a revelation. I used to struggle with sunglasses causing pressure points, but with Oakley’s design, especially the Oakley Frogskins and BiSphaera, I barely notice I’m wearing them. They fit like a glove and stay put during swings, which was a concern of mine.
